Forget the humour a minute, even leave out the social functions. Right at the "guts" of AussieFrogs was a committed group (by no means a static collection; people came and went) - who shared what they were doing, with the idea it might benefit or inspire others.

David_S and the Xantia antisink valve. Magic and his incredible "lobster back". Double Chevron and his CX respray. Dino's shed. Gibgib and his 2CV rebuild. Owen Wuillemin's CNC mastery. The list could go on for ages.

To me (and a good few others, who may or may not post much), that was the kind of stuff which kept people coming back. Mocking it by assuming usernames and engaging in pretend antics, was a petty spoiling of the good bits.

That's why some of us got a bit irate! It's a three-dimensional thing, with real people, real cars and real grime and that element deserves respect.
